Spam Filter Help
 
I am having trouble I want to download a movie but several spam results emerge.I Know the basics of spam file prevention as i have been a devout limewire user for years (but it seems the spam has increased drastically)
The methods I am using are
1.Not downloading from T3 or T1
2.Filtering wmv and exe files
3.blocking spam ip adresses
Now number three is the thing I need help on, It would save me days of trouble if someone could post a list of ips to block or help me find a previously compiled one.

There's been an increase in the number of fake files lately, they sit connecting & then show 'need more sources' but won't ever download.
Probably more important that avoiding T1 & T3 is avoiding files with heaps of sources. Go for a file with 10 sources or less, or those with a modem source are usually ok. Now that faster internet is more affordable, more people have a T1 or T3 speed...so lots of these sources are quite ok. Not to say that you can trust every T3, but I've seen plenty of spam/fakes showing with cable/dsl sources.

Always check a file with Bitzi before download.
How to use Bitzi
A file with lots of sources but no Bitzi rating is often a fake.

You can block the IPs of people hosting spam files but in a couple of days, when their IP changes & someone else takes on the original IP...you're banning the wrong person:wink:
